Beshenkovichi District Prosecutor's Office sent a criminal case of property embezzlement by a group of persons to court

The Beshenkovichi District Prosecutor's Office sent a criminal case to court concerning the embezzlement of property entrusted to a person, committed by a group of persons by prior conspiracy.
According to the case materials, employees of one of the district's organizations – local residents Ya. and L., being financially responsible persons, from May to October 2023, at their workplace, embezzled inventory items of the enterprise entrusted to them, amounting to over 4 thousand Belarusian rubles.After reviewing the materials of the criminal case, the district prosecutor's office concluded that the accusation was justified and the circumstances of the crime were objectively investigated. They agreed with the qualification of the actions of Ya. and L. under Part 2 of Article 211 of the Criminal Code of the Republic of Belarus.
The criminal case was handled by the Beshenkovichi District Department of the Investigative Committee of the Republic of Belarus.
The prosecutor, when sending the case to court, left unchanged the preventive measure applied to the accused in the form of a recognizance not to leave and proper conduct.
The district prosecutor explains that the sanction of Part 2 of Article 211 of the Criminal Code of the Republic of Belarus provides for punishment in the form of restriction of liberty for a term of two to five years or deprivation of liberty for a term of two to five years with or without a fine and with or without deprivation of the right to hold certain positions or engage in certain activities.In this case, the amount of the fine is set within thirty to one thousand basic units.
